Performance: BMC air filters are designed and produced to ensure higher air flow than the original paper filters. In F1, BMC fiberglass filters minimize the loss of air flow pressure passing through the filter, ensuring the best conditions for fully exploiting maximum power. The benefits of replacing the original paper filter with the BMC fiberglass air filter are evident.
Design and Materials: BMC's specialized engineers use advanced software and the latest technologies to manufacture the air filters. Only braided alloys with epoxy coating are used to ensure protection against gasoline fumes and oxidation due to humidity. The filtering material consists of a special cotton gauze impregnated with low viscosity oil for better air permeability.
Advanced Technology: BMC's technical staff has developed a production system based on soft rubber molding, which produces the red BMC filters. They are manufactured in a single piece with no welded joints at the corners, avoiding the risk of breakage. This system comes from R&D in F1 and is significant for the technical and quality characteristics of BMC air filters.
